Chennai Super Kings (CSK) becomes the first team to qualify for final after they beat table topper Sunrises Hyderabad (SRH) in Qualifier 1 on Tuesday at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ai. With the victory, CSK reaches the final for a record seventh time in their nine years of play.

Winning the toss, CSK opted to bowl and chase down the target looking at the condition. CSK bowlers did a terrific work by restricting the opponents in just 139. Carlos Brathwaite was the lone warrior who scored an unbeaten 43 runs off just 29 deliveries to take his team to a respected total.

Coming to chase, the men in yellow lost their wickets early and never got a chance to recover it. South African batsman Faf Du Plessis who got the chance to play made the most of it. He won the match for the team single handed by scoring unbeaten 67 off 42 balls. Shardul Thakur’s cameo of 15 off just 5 deliveries proved very crucial for the successful chase.

CSK players looked delightful after the victory and celebrated it. All-rounder Dwayne Bravo celebrated the victory by singing and dancing in the dressing room. A video was posted by the official Twitter handle of the franchise in which Bravo and Harbhajan were dancing in front of the CSK skipper. Dhoni is sitting on a chair and the players are paying a tribute to him.

The tweet read, “Champion’s groovy tribute to #Thala after getting through to the #Finale! #WhistlePodu #yellove @msdhoni.”

Returning after the 2-year ban, CSK again dominated the tournament and showed how the champions do a comeback. It will be 8th IPL final for the CSK skipper which is a record.

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) and Rajasthan Royals (RR) will play Eliminator on Wednesday at Eden Gardens. The winning team will take on Sunrises Hyderabad in Qualifier 2 on May 25 at the same venue.
